Calculate dividends using the accounting equation At the beginning of its current fiscal year, Willie Corp.'s balance sheet showed assets of $12,400 and liabilities of $7,000. During the year, liabilities decreased by $1,200. Net income for the year was $3,000, and net assets at the end of the year were $6,000. There were no changes in paid-in capital during the year.
Required:
Calculate the dividends, if any, declared during the year.
